Transaction 328f95557f75b4de695cfd4cbcf52e93872eb31eb9154cb0a3f6fde4b4a45588
1 Input
1 Output
-
328f95557f75b4de695cfd4cbcf52e93872eb31eb9154cb0a3f6fde4b4a45588:0
- value
- 51758
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fcd39327d70ff76216d710d823576413317330e8 OP_EQUAL
- address
- 3QjqfMvzEhXBAWenrWHcJqc86JAdG9LAAh